HiyaHiya Stainless Steel Circular Needles have a slick but not too slick, smooth finish, … Web22 feb. 2024 · You would use slightly smaller needles, 4mm or size 6 US approx, for knitting a blanket with DK yarn. Lighter blankets and baby shawls knit with 4 ply or fingering weight yarn need 3 – 4mm needles, most often size 3.25 mm or size US 3. Web9 jul. 2024 · 4mm = 5/32 inch (= a bit over 1/8 inch) 5mm = just over 3/16 inch. 6mm = almost 1/4 inch. 7mm = almost 9/32 inch (= a bit over 1/4 inch). WebThe shortest knitting needles are 7 inches (17.78 cm), which are made for children. The lengths of needles range from 8 inches (20.32 cm) to 16 inches (40.64 cm). There also is a range of the gauge of knitting needles, ranging from 2 mm to 10 mm (or the American metric of 0 to 15). As a fun piece of trivia, the largest and longest knitting ...

Web9 jul. 2024 · Double knitting yarn is defined as an 8-ply thread that has between 11-14 wraps per inch resulting in around 200-250 meters per 100 grams.
